Jalapeno Popper Mummies

Spooky Jalapeno Popper Mummies for a Fun Halloween Treat

Delightful Jalapeno Popper Mummies blend creamy cheese with jalapenos, wrapped in flaky pastry for a spooky Halloween treat.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Total Time 32 minutes
Servings: 12 mummies
Course: Appetizers
Cuisine: American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Filling
  • 8 oz Cream Cheese Substitution: Use reduced-fat cream cheese for a lighter version.
  • 1 cup Monterey Jack Cheese Substitution: Sharp cheddar or a 3-cheese blend can be used for more flavor.
  • 1 tsp Garlic Powder No substitutions needed.
  • 1 tsp Onion Powder No substitutions needed.
  • 1 tsp Salt Adjust to taste.
  • 1/2 tsp Black Pepper No substitutions needed.
  • 4 count Jalapenos Preparation Note: To reduce heat, remove seeds and ribs.
For the Pastry
  • 1 can Pillsbury Crescent Rolls Alternative: Use puff pastry if desired.
  • 1 count Egg for egg wash. No substitutions needed.
For Decoration
  • 1 count Candy Eyeballs or Sliced Olives Substitution: Sliced black olives can replace candy eyeballs for a less sweet option.

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Baking Tray
  • mixing bowl
  • Knife or Pizza Cutter

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king tray with aluminum foil. Lightly spray with cooking spray.
  2. Slice jalapenos in half lengthwise and scoop out the seeds and inner pith. Lay the halved jalapenos on the prepared baking tray.
  3. In a mixing bowl, combine cream cheese, Monterey Jack c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and black pepper. Blend until smooth.
  4. Generously fill each jalapeno half with the cheese mixture, creating a nice mound.
  5. Unroll the Pillsbury Crescent Rolls and separate into rectangles by sealing the seams. Slice each rectangle into thin strips.
  6. Wrap the cheese-stuffed jalapenos with dough strips, overlapping them to create a mummy look.
  7. Arrange wrapped jalapenos on the baking tray and brush egg wash over the dough strips.
  8. Bake for about 12 minutes until golden brown and crispy.
  9. Let cool slightly and decorate with candy eyeballs or sliced olives.

Notes

These Jalapeno Popper Mummies can be prepared in advance and stored in an airtight container for easy baking later.
